| Pathway to Discovery - Casestudy |
02/06/2010 |
| Nottinghamshire Health Care NHS Trust "Pathway to Discovery was born from a realisation of the need for individuals living through personal difficulties as a result of a personality disorder to share their experiences." A book containing their thoughts, art and poetry was created. (Literacy & numeracy support was embedded into the process of creating this book with the support of the LSIS SfL Support Programme.) |

| Chicken Feed Web Quest - Resources | 24/05/2010 |
| PALS (Nottinghamshire Probation Service and Dyslexia Action) share a Quick Reads inspired resource. ”The ‘Chickenfeed’ web quest has been designed to be used by adult literacy learners, who voted the book as their favourite from the Quick Reads’ series.” The web quest provides a range of activities and can be used for literacy levels Entry 3 up to Level 2. The quest can be used in a number of ways. Created with support from the LSIS SfL Support Programme. |

| A Guide to supporting Skills for Life and Functional Skills using a Virtual Learning Environment | 20/05/2010 |
| Leicester College share their guide to supporting SfL and Functional Skills using moodle. They have set up a VLE accessible 24 hours a day from any location. It is available to all their staff and learners regardless of subject. It offers support with developing English, ESOL, Maths and ICT skills. Created with the support of the LSIS SfL Support Programme. |
